From 1031e469264d74bd07ddbe99ac6c5649ce2b85b7 Mon Sep 17 00:00:00 2001 From: pengandpeng Date: Sat, 6 Feb 2021 13:46:43 +0800 Subject: [PATCH] fix: table scroll.x throw error when use expandedRowRender (#3626)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 表头固定与展开行不存在冲突,结合使用时不应该报错 --- components/table/Table.jsx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/components/table/Table.jsx b/components/table/Table.jsx index 96921909f..73e7a9933 100755 --- a/components/table/Table.jsx +++ b/components/table/Table.jsx @@ -141,7 +141,7 @@ export default { // this.columns = props.columns || normalizeColumns(props.children) const props = getOptionProps(this); warning( - !props.expandedRowRender || !('scroll' in props), + !props.expandedRowRender || !('scroll' in props) || !props.scroll.x, '`expandedRowRender` and `scroll` are not compatible. Please use one of them at one time.', ); this.CheckboxPropsCache = {};